Disney’s beloved family sitcom Malcolm in the Middle returns with a limited four-episode revival titled Life’s Still Unfair, streaming exclusively on Hulu and Disney+ starting April 10, 2026. Unlike some weekly releases, all episodes drop at once for a binge experience. The series reunites the chaotic Wilkerson family after nearly 20 years, focusing on grown-up Malcolm navigating family mayhem.

Release Schedule of Malcolm in the Middle: Life’s Still Unfair Episodes

Malcolm in the Middle: Life’s Still Unfair consists of four episodes, all premiering simultaneously on April 10, 2026, marking a full drop rather than weekly installments. Episode titles remain TBA, with global rollout timed to local regions via Hulu in the US, Hulu on Disney+ for bundles, and Disney+ internationally—including expected availability on JioHotstar in India. Drops typically align with early morning US times (e.g., around 12:01 a.m. PT / 3:01 a.m. ET), translating to afternoon IST for Indian viewers.

Cast

The revival brings back most of the original ensemble, with some recasts and new additions.

  • Frankie Muniz as Malcolm Wilkerson

  • Bryan Cranston as Hal Wilkerson

  • Jane Kaczmarek as Lois Wilkerson

  • Christopher Masterson as Francis Wilkerson

  • Justin Berfield as Reese Wilkerson

  • Caleb Ellsworth-Clark as Dewey Wilkerson (replacing Erik Per Sullivan)

  • Emy Coligado as Piama Wilkerson

  • Keeley Karsten as Leah (Malcolm’s daughter)

  • Kiana Madeira as Tristan (Malcolm’s girlfriend)

  • Vaughan Murrae as Kelly (new sibling)

Plot Overview

Malcolm in the Middle originally followed genius kid Malcolm Wilkerson navigating life with his dysfunctional family from 2000 to 2006. The revival picks up years later: After shielding himself and his daughter from the family for over a decade, adult Malcolm gets dragged back when Hal and Lois demand his presence at their 40th wedding anniversary party. Where to Watch Malcolm in the Middle: Life’s Still Unfair?

Malcolm in the Middle: Life’s Still Unfair streams exclusively on Hulu and Hulu on Disney+ (for US bundle subscribers), with Disney+ internationally on April 10, 2026. In India, expect it on JioHotstar or Disney+ Hotstar, aligning with local Disney content patterns. All 151 episodes of the original series are currently available on Hulu, Hulu on Disney+, and Disney+ globally for catch-up viewing.

What to Expect From Upcoming Episodes?

The revival promises the classic mix of quirky family antics, Malcolm’s narration, and escalating mishaps centered on the anniversary reunion. New dynamics—like Malcolm’s daughter meeting the Wilkersons and recast siblings—add fresh layers to the over-the-top humor and heartfelt moments that defined the original. As a self-contained four-episode arc directed entirely by Ken Kwapis, it teases potential for more while recapturing the sitcom’s irreverent spirit.
